Smooth Cast Iron Skillet Vs Rough

 

When it comes to cast iron skillets, one of the most debated topics is whether a smooth or rough cooking surface is better. The choice can affect not only your cooking experience but also the long-term performance of your cookware. Smooth Cast Iron Skillet 

 

A smooth cast iron skillet has a finely polished cooking surface, often achieved through machining or enamel coating. The benefits include:

Effortless Release: Foods like eggs and fish are less likely to stick, especially with proper seasoning.

Easy Cleaning: The smooth texture wipes clean more easily.

Ideal for Delicate Dishes: Perfect for pancakes, crepes, and other foods that benefit from a slick surface.

Rough Cast Iron Skillet 

 

A rough cast iron skillet retains the slightly textured surface from the sand-casting process. This micro-texture has its own advantages:

Better Seasoning Bond: The rougher surface allows seasoning layers to adhere strongly over time.

Enhanced Browning: Texture creates micro points of contact for crisp, flavorful sears.

Durable and Rustic: Often preferred by traditionalists for its heritage feel.

Which One Is Right for You?


If you value non-stick convenience and easy cleanup, a smooth skillet—especially an enameled cast iron skillet—is a great choice. If you enjoy building seasoning layers and achieving bold, charred flavors, the rough surface is ideal. Many professional kitchens use both for different tasks.

Different Cast Iron Skillets – Which One is Right for You?

 

A cast iron skillet is one of the most versatile tools in any kitchen, but not all skillets are the same. The type you choose can greatly influence your cooking results and maintenance routine. 1.  Seasoned Cast Iron Skillet


A seasoned cast iron skillet comes pre-treated with vegetable oil, giving it a natural non-stick surface that improves with every use. This is the go-to choice for traditionalists who love the rich flavor development and high heat searing. 2. Enameled Cast Iron Skillet


An enameled cast iron skillet features a protective, colorful coating that eliminates the need for seasoning. It’s ideal for cooking acidic dishes like tomato sauces, as the enamel prevents any reaction with the food. 3. Deep Cast Iron Skillet


For dishes that need more volume—like fried chicken, stews, or one-pan pasta—deep skillets are the perfect choice. They provide extra capacity without sacrificing the heat retention cast iron is famous for.

 

4. Grill Pan Skillet


A cast iron grill pan skillet comes with raised ridges, creating perfect sear marks while allowing excess fat to drain away. It’s perfect for grilling indoors and achieving that outdoor BBQ flavor.

 

5. Mini Cast Iron Skillet


Mini skillets are great for single servings, desserts, or table presentation. They heat quickly and make a unique addition to your cookware set.
